The South Korea Medical Robotics Market is a highly dynamic and technologically advanced sector, positioning the nation as a significant player in the global medical automation landscape. This market is dedicated to the research, development, manufacturing, and deployment of sophisticated robotic systems designed to revolutionize various aspects of healthcare delivery. The scope is comprehensive, encompassing precision surgical robots that enable minimally invasive procedures, advanced rehabilitation robots that aid in patient recovery and therapy, intelligent hospital automation robots that streamline logistics and pharmacy operations, and diagnostic robots that enhance efficiency and accuracy. These systems integrate cutting-edge technologies such as artificial intelligence, advanced sensors, real-time imaging, and haptic feedback, allowing for unparalleled levels of precision, consistency, and efficiency in clinical settings.

The robust growth of the South Korea Medical Robotics Market is fundamentally driven by a confluence of powerful factors. A primary driver is the nation's rapidly aging population, which creates an urgent need for innovative healthcare solutions to manage increasing patient volumes and the rising prevalence of chronic diseases. Concurrently, strong government initiatives and significant funding aimed at promoting medical technology development and integrating robotics into healthcare systems are providing substantial impetus for market expansion. The increasing demand for minimally invasive surgeries, preferred for faster patient recovery times and reduced hospital stays, further propels the adoption of robotic assistance. In essence, the South Korea Medical Robotics Market plays a pivotal role in modernizing healthcare infrastructure, improving patient outcomes, enhancing operational efficiency, and addressing the unique challenges of healthcare delivery for its technologically forward-thinking population, solidifying South Korea's position as a global leader in medical robotics.

Recent Developments in the South Korea Medical Robotics Market

The South Korea Medical Robotics Market is marked by a flurry of recent developments and ongoing innovations that underscore its rapid growth and strategic importance. One of the most significant trends is the increasing demand for minimally invasive surgical procedures. Patients and healthcare providers are increasingly preferring these procedures due to their benefits, including quicker recovery times, reduced pain, and fewer post-operative complications. This preference directly fuels the adoption of advanced surgical robots, which offer enhanced precision, dexterity, and visualization for complex operations. Hospitals across South Korea are actively investing in these robotic systems to provide state-of-the-art care, reflecting a broader trend of facilities upgrading their capabilities to meet modern medical standards.

Government initiatives and strategic plans are playing a crucial role in accelerating the development and widespread integration of medical robotics. The South Korean government has demonstrated a strong commitment to fostering innovation in this field, exemplified by initiatives such as the "K-Medical Robot" plan. This plan aims to strategically integrate robotics into various healthcare settings, providing substantial funding and support for research and development activities, particularly within hospitals and academic institutions. For instance, the Ministry of Health and Welfare has allocated significant budgets towards enhancing medical technology, with reports indicating a substantial increase in funding for medical robotics innovation in recent years. This governmental backing provides a stable foundation for long-term market growth and technological advancement.

Furthermore, there is a notable surge in collaboration between healthcare providers and technology companies. South Korean hospitals are actively partnering with robotics firms and research institutions to foster the development of cutting-edge robotic technologies. These collaborations often lead to the creation of bespoke solutions tailored to specific clinical needs, as well as the establishment of specialized training programs for medical personnel. This ensures that surgeons and other healthcare professionals are adequately skilled in effectively utilizing these advanced robotic systems, addressing the crucial need for a skilled workforce in this evolving landscape.

The market is also witnessing continuous innovations in equipment that enhances surgical precision and recovery times, alongside the increasing integration of these advanced technologies into clinical settings. This includes the development of more compact and versatile robotic systems, improved haptic feedback mechanisms for surgeons, and advanced imaging capabilities integrated directly into robotic platforms. The high robot density in South Korea's manufacturing sector also indicates a strong industrial base and technological expertise that can be leveraged for medical robotics. Lastly, the rapidly aging population is prompting an increased demand for various healthcare services, including robotic-assisted surgeries and rehabilitation, which is a significant factor driving market growth. As South Korea continues to position itself as a leader in medical robotics, the convergence of healthcare innovation and technological prowess is expected to unlock new frontiers in patient care and operational efficiency.
